Abstract

The present invention features, inter alia, purified antibodies that selectively bind an isolated or recombinant histone deacetylase polypeptide comprising the amino acid sequence as set forth in SEQ ID NO: 2, which comprises a histone deacetylase catalytic domain at amino acids 635 to 953 of SEQ ID NO: 2, purified antibodies that selectively bind a biologically active fragment of the polypeptide of SEQ ID NO: 2, which fragment exhibits histone deacetylase activity, transcription repression activity, and the ability to deacetylate cellular substrates, purified antibodies that selectively bind an isolated or recombinant histone deacetylase polypeptide encoded by a nucleotide sequence as set forth in SEQ ID NO: 1, purified antibodies that selectively bind an isolated or recombinant histone deacetylase polypeptide comprising the amino acid sequence as set forth in SEQ ID NO: 2 lacking a nuclear localization signal, and purified antibodies that selectively bind an isolated or recombinant histone deacetylase polypeptide having at least 95% amino acid sequence identity to SEQ ID NO: 2 and which exhibits histone deacetylase activity, transcription repression activity, and the ability to d…
